St. John’s Wort enhances the synaptic activity of the nucleus of the solitary tract
OBJECTIVE: St. John’s Wort extract, which is commonly used to treat depression, inhibits the reuptake of several neurotransmitters, including glutamate, serotonin, norepinephrine, and dopamine.
